Important Points to Remember – Class 11 Maths

  • Sets are well-defined collections of objects where membership can be clearly determined, forming the foundation for modern mathematics as developed by Georg Cantor (1845-1918)
  • A complex number is written as a + ib where ‘a’ is the real part (Re z) and ‘b’ is the imaginary part (Im z), with i = √(-1)
  • Two complex numbers z₁ = a + ib and z₂ = c + id are equal if and only if a = c and b = d
  • Cartesian product P × Q is the set of all ordered pairs (p,q) where p ∈ P and q ∈ Q
  • Trigonometric functions are generalizations of trigonometric ratios studied in earlier classes for acute angles only
  • Angles measured anticlockwise are positive while angles measured clockwise are negative from the initial side to terminal side
  • Relations involve pairs of objects in certain order, while functions are special relations with mathematically precise correspondence
  • The equation x² + 1 = 0 has no real solution, necessitating the introduction of complex numbers in CBSE 2025-26 curriculum
  • Set notation uses symbols like N (natural numbers), Z (integers), Q (rational numbers), and R (real numbers)
  • Trigonometry derives from Greek words ‘trigon’ (triangle) and ‘metron’ (measuring), originally used for navigation and surveying
  • Complex number addition follows the rule: (a + ib) + (c + id) = (a + c) + i(b + d)
  • One complete revolution represents 360° or 2π radians as fundamental angle measurement units
  • Ordered pairs in Cartesian products maintain specific sequence, making (p,q) different from (q,p)
  • Arya Bhatta (476-550 CE) made significant contributions to trigonometry as mentioned in NCERT textbooks
  • Set theory applications extend to geometry, sequences, probability, relations, and functions in Class 11 mathematics

Quick Revision Notes – Class 11 Maths

  • Remember that sets can be represented in three ways: roster form {1,3,5,7,9}, set-builder form {x: x is odd, x < 10}, and Venn diagrams for visual representation
  • For complex numbers, always separate real and imaginary parts when solving equations; equate real parts with real parts and imaginary parts with imaginary parts
  • In trigonometric functions, memorize that angles can be measured in degrees, radians, and gradians with conversion formulas being crucial for board exams
  • Cartesian products are not commutative: A × B ≠ B × A unless A = B, which frequently appears in CBSE objective questions
  • When working with sets, focus on subset relationships, proper subsets, universal sets, and complement operations for comprehensive understanding
  • Complex number operations follow real number algebra rules with the additional property that i² = -1, i³ = -i, i⁴ = 1
  • Trigonometric identities from Class 10 remain valid and form the foundation for Class 11 trigonometric functions and their properties
  • Relations can be represented using arrow diagrams, ordered pairs, or matrices – practice all three methods for board exam preparation
  • Set operations include union (∪), intersection (∩), difference (-), and complement (‘) with specific properties and De Morgan’s laws
  • Functions require each element in domain to have exactly one image in codomain, distinguishing them from general relations
  • Complex plane representation uses horizontal axis for real parts and vertical axis for imaginary parts, similar to coordinate geometry
  • Radian measure is often preferred in calculus and higher mathematics; π radians = 180° is the fundamental conversion
  • Empty set (∅) and universal set (U) have special properties in set operations and appear frequently in CBSE board questions
  • Trigonometric functions of allied angles and negative angles follow specific patterns that simplify complex problems
  • Domain and range concepts for relations and functions connect directly to set theory, making comprehensive study essential
